NBA Opening Night and Christmas Day Odds: Analysts Favor Cavs, Rockets, and Spurs for Surprises
August 14, 2025
For opening night, Snellings favors the Los Angeles Lakers (-155) over the Golden State Warriors, citing the Lakers' improved health, Luka Doncic's peak condition, and their offseason improvements.
Snellings favors the Cleveland Cavaliers (+3.5) over the New York Knicks, pointing to the Cavs' dominance in last season's matchups and questioning the line given their proven performance.
Moody predicts the Houston Rockets to upset the Oklahoma City Thunder with a +200 money line, emphasizing the Rockets' roster reloading, star power including Kevin Durant, and the vulnerability of defending champions in season openers.
As the NBA season approaches, early betting odds for opening night on October 21 and Christmas Day games are already generating buzz, with expert predictions from analysts like Andre Snellings and Eric Moody.
Looking ahead to Christmas Day, Moody expects the San Antonio Spurs to cover a +9.5 spread against the Thunder, highlighting Wembanyama's impact, the team's depth, and their young talent.
